pub enum BundlePermission {
Read,
Write,
ReadWrite,
Full,
None,
PreviewOnly,
}
Expand description
Bundle permissions enum
Variants§
Read
Read-only access
Write
Write-only access (upload)
ReadWrite
Read and write access
Full
Full access
None
No access
PreviewOnly
Preview only (no download)
Trait Implementations§
Source§impl Clone for BundlePermission
impl Clone for BundlePermission
Source§fn clone(&self) -> BundlePermission
fn clone(&self) -> BundlePermission
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for BundlePermission
impl Debug for BundlePermission
Source§impl<'de> Deserialize<'de> for BundlePermission
impl<'de> Deserialize<'de> for BundlePermission
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for BundlePermission
impl RefUnwindSafe for BundlePermission
impl Send for BundlePermission
impl Sync for BundlePermission
impl Unpin for BundlePermission
impl UnwindSafe for BundlePermission
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more